COVID Active Cases Drop Below 5K In Odisha; 50% In Khurda

Bhubaneswar: The daily COVID caseload in Odisha dropped below 400 again on Monday as 340 more people, including 50 in the age group of 0-18 years, tested positive for the virus in the last 24 hours. 

On Sunday, the infection had soared by 25 per cent despite a fall in testing by 20 per cent. The state had seen 443 new cases compared to 358 the previous day. With 55,115 samples against the targetted 70,000 being tested, the test positivity rate (TPR) stood at 0.80 per cent.

The TRP for Monday was 0.59 per cent with the positive cases being detected from 57293 samples.

According to the I & PR department, 199 are from quarantine and 141 local contacts. Khurda district registered the highest 149 new infections, followed by Cuttack at 43. There were nil cases in nine districts.

Besides, 36 are from the state pool.

While the affected tally has touched 1035417, Odisha now has 4824 active cases. Khurda is in the yellow zone with 2410 active cases.
